Understand the difference between somatic and autonomic motor neurons: Somatic motor neurons are part of the somatic nervous system and control voluntary movements, while autonomic motor neurons are part of the autonomic nervous system and regulate involuntary functions.
Recall the types of muscles in the human body: Skeletal muscles are responsible for voluntary movements, while smooth and cardiac muscles are involved in involuntary functions such as digestion and heart contractions.
Match the somatic motor neurons to the type of muscle they control: Somatic motor neurons control skeletal muscles, which are under voluntary control.
Match the autonomic motor neurons to the type of muscle they control: Autonomic motor neurons control smooth and cardiac muscles, which are involved in involuntary processes.
Confirm the correct answer based on the definitions and muscle types: Somatic motor neurons control skeletal muscles, while autonomic motor neurons control smooth and cardiac muscles.
